Carte du Théâtre de la Guerre en Virginie, ca. 1863

 Item — Box: 3, Folder: 7
Identifier: id227332

Scope and Contents

Showing railroads, towns, rivers of Eastern Virginia during the Civil War.

August Bry, Paris - engraver

in color

14 mi to 1 in

44 cm x 39 cm

Purchased by the Presson fund from Moebs Catalog 23, January 22, 1993 (Mss.Acc. 1993.09)

Subject/Index Terms: United States--History--Civil War, 1861-1865--Peninsula Campaign--Maps.
